Analysis

The most recent figure for coverage in 2nd quintile (%) - unconditional cash transfers in Romania is 58.0%, measured in 2021. That is the lowest value across all 7 years on record.

That represents a change of down 8.7% on the previous year and down 9.4% over ten years.

Over the whole period, coverage in 2nd quintile (%) - unconditional cash transfers in Romania peaked at 64.0% in 2011 and was at its lowest, 58.0%, in 2021.

That places Romania 7th out of 28 countries with data for 2021, putting it in the top quarter.
